WASHINGTON, May 30 -- The U.S. Department of Education issued the following news release:
U.S. Secretary of Education Betsy DeVos announced the Department of Education has approved nine additional career and technical education (CTE) state plans. Georgia, Iowa, Michigan, Montana, North Dakota, Oregon, South Dakota, Vermont, and Wyoming are the latest states to have their CTE plans approved under the new, bipartisan Strengthening Career and Technical Education for the 21stCentury Act . . .
